Output 3fdc0986d8b5b3910df8c687f141bb4b7f8c800e7e886efecc8ca88c107fbe3b:13

value
59049
script pubkey
OP_0 OP_PUSHBYTES_20 cc417c8aff6b91e64a6a58d3c39c035cd3b217ab
address
tb1qe3qhezhldwg7vjn2trfu88qrtnfmy9athz85pl
transaction
3fdc0986d8b5b3910df8c687f141bb4b7f8c800e7e886efecc8ca88c107fbe3b
confirmations
18826
spent
true